Samsung Owes Microsoft Over $1 Billion

Back in 2010, Microsoft started bringing legal action against Android stakeholders, which resulted in various licensing deals. The company refused to announce what was being licensed to the stakeholders – 25 of them, including Foxconn, HTC, ZTE and Samsung. Tablet Growth Shifts Away From Market Leaders

Worldwide branded tablet shipments are set to remain below 200 million this year, with growth at a ‘disappointing’ 2.5% YoY, says ABI Research. Access Essential Gaming Functions on Asus’ G751

Asus’ new gaming laptop, the 17.3″ ROG G751, is part of the Republic of Gamers line. Programmable macro and quick-launch (for Steam, games and other commonly-used features) keys on the (backlit) keyboard help gamers control the action, and a new ‘ROG Key’, on the numpad, launches the Gaming Centre dashboard. Asus…And Expandable Tablet Storage

Asus’ latest Transformer Book hybrid tablet, the T200, features user-upgradable storage in the keyboard dock. Owners can undo a panel on the base of the device to add a 1TB HDD, in addition to the 32GB eMMC/64GB eMMC/32GB with 500GB HDD options that are available as standard. HTC’s ‘Selfie Phone’ Responds to Voice Commands

While smartphones’ front-facing cameras have often been outclassed by those on the rear, recent months have seen a change in this trend. The latest smartphone to pack a powerful front camera is the HTC Desire Eye, a 5.2″ model with 13MP cameras on both sides. Despite the matched resolution, the cameras are not identical.
